/* > \par Purpose: */
/* ============= */
/* > */
/* > \verbatim */
/* > */
/* > DLALSD uses the singular value decomposition of A to solve the least */
/* > squares problem of finding X to minimize the Euclidean norm of each */
/* > column of A*X-B, where A is N-by-N upper bidiagonal, and X and B */
/* > are N-by-NRHS. The solution X overwrites B. */
/* > */
/* > The singular values of A smaller than RCOND times the largest */
/* > singular value are treated as zero in solving the least squares */
/* > problem; in this case a minimum norm solution is returned. */
/* > The actual singular values are returned in D in ascending order. */
/* > */
/* > This code makes very mild assumptions about floating point */
/* > arithmetic. It will work on machines with a guard digit in */
/* > add/subtract, or on those binary machines without guard digits */
/* > which subtract like the Cray XMP, Cray YMP, Cray C 90, or Cray 2. */
/* > It could conceivably fail on hexadecimal or decimal machines */
/* > without guard digits, but we know of none. */
/* > \endverbatim */
/* Arguments: */
/* ========== */
/* > \param[in] UPLO */
/* > \verbatim */
/* > UPLO is CHARACTER*1 */
/* > = 'U': D and E define an upper bidiagonal matrix. */
/* > = 'L': D and E define a lower bidiagonal matrix. */
/* > \endverbatim */
/* > */
/* > \param[in] SMLSIZ */
/* > \verbatim */
/* > SMLSIZ is INTEGER */
/* > The maximum size of the subproblems at the bottom of the */
/* > computation tree. */
/* > \endverbatim */
/* > */
/* > \param[in] N */
/* > \verbatim */
/* > N is INTEGER */
/* > The dimension of the bidiagonal matrix. N >= 0. */
/* > \endverbatim */
/* > */
/* > \param[in] NRHS */
/* > \verbatim */
/* > NRHS is INTEGER */
/* > The number of columns of B. NRHS must be at least 1. */
/* > \endverbatim */
/* > */
/* > \param[in,out] D */
/* > \verbatim */
/* > D is DOUBLE PRECISION array, dimension (N) */
/* > On entry D contains the main diagonal of the bidiagonal */
/* > matrix. On exit, if INFO = 0, D contains its singular values. */
/* > \endverbatim */
/* > */
/* > \param[in,out] E */
/* > \verbatim */
/* > E is DOUBLE PRECISION array, dimension (N-1) */
/* > Contains the super-diagonal entries of the bidiagonal matrix. */
/* > On exit, E has been destroyed. */
/* > \endverbatim */
/* > */
/* > \param[in,out] B */
/* > \verbatim */
/* > B is DOUBLE PRECISION array, dimension (LDB,NRHS) */
/* > On input, B contains the right hand sides of the least */
/* > squares problem. On output, B contains the solution X. */
/* > \endverbatim */
/* > */
/* > \param[in] LDB */
/* > \verbatim */
/* > LDB is INTEGER */
/* > The leading dimension of B in the calling subprogram. */
/* > LDB must be at least f2cmax(1,N). */
/* > \endverbatim */
/* > */
/* > \param[in] RCOND */
/* > \verbatim */
/* > RCOND is DOUBLE PRECISION */
/* > The singular values of A less than or equal to RCOND times */
/* > the largest singular value are treated as zero in solving */
/* > the least squares problem. If RCOND is negative, */
/* > machine precision is used instead. */
/* > For example, if diag(S)*X=B were the least squares problem, */
/* > where diag(S) is a diagonal matrix of singular values, the */
/* > solution would be X(i) = B(i) / S(i) if S(i) is greater than */
/* > RCOND*f2cmax(S), and X(i) = 0 if S(i) is less than or equal to */
/* > RCOND*f2cmax(S). */
/* > \endverbatim */
/* > */
/* > \param[out] RANK */
/* > \verbatim */
/* > RANK is INTEGER */
/* > The number of singular values of A greater than RCOND times */
/* > the largest singular value. */
/* > \endverbatim */
/* > */
/* > \param[out] WORK */
/* > \verbatim */
/* > WORK is DOUBLE PRECISION array, dimension at least */
/* > (9*N + 2*N*SMLSIZ + 8*N*NLVL + N*NRHS + (SMLSIZ+1)**2), */
/* > where NLVL = f2cmax(0, INT(log_2 (N/(SMLSIZ+1))) + 1). */
/* > \endverbatim */
/* > */
/* > \param[out] IWORK */
/* > \verbatim */
/* > IWORK is INTEGER array, dimension at least */
/* > (3*N*NLVL + 11*N) */
/* > \endverbatim */
/* > */
/* > \param[out] INFO */
/* > \verbatim */
/* > INFO is INTEGER */
/* > = 0: successful exit. */
/* > < 0: if INFO = -i, the i-th argument had an illegal value. */
/* > > 0: The algorithm failed to compute a singular value while */
/* > working on the submatrix lying in rows and columns */
/* > INFO/(N+1) through MOD(INFO,N+1). */
/* > \endverbatim */
